QA Automation Lead

Trella Health
Summary
Join Trella Health as a seasoned QA Automation Lead to architect and drive the automation strategy. You will build scalable automation frameworks spanning UI, API, mobile, and data validation, defining the automation roadmap, selecting tools, and implementing best practices. This role involves integrating automation into the development lifecycle, mentoring QA team members, and fostering a culture of quality engineering. The position is remote-first, with a preference for candidates near regional hubs (Atlanta, Nashville, Philadelphia), but considers qualified applicants in other U.S. locations. You will report to the Director, Quality Assurance and be responsible for creating and owning automation strategy documentation, coding guidelines, and onboarding guides for team members. Requirements
- 7+ years in QA Automation, with 3+ years leading automation framework development from scratch
- Expertise in automation tools and libraries such as Playwright, Cypress, REST-assured, Postman, PyTest, etc
- Proficiency in one or more modern programming languages (TypeScript, JavaScript, Python, or Java)
- Demonstrated experience architecting automated solutions for UI, API, data validation, and mobile testing
- Deep knowledge of CI/CD integration using GitHub Actions, Azure DevOps, or Jenkins
- Strong grasp of QA strategy, test design techniques, and coverage models
- Experience integrating with test management platforms (e.g., TestRail)
- Excellent communication skills, with a passion for mentorship and knowledge sharing
Responsibilities
- Architect and implement a modular, scalable automation framework that supports UI, API, mobile, and data testing
- Evaluate and select appropriate tools, languages, and libraries for each layer of the automation stack
- Define coding standards, folder structures, reusable components, and best practices for test development
- Integrate automated tests into CI/CD pipelines for continuous test execution and reporting
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ams including QA, DevOps, and engineering to embed automation into the SDLC
- Track and report automation metrics and coverage; drive visibility via dashboards and reporting tools
- Integrate automation execution and results into TestRail
- Mentor manual testers and junior engineers transitioning into automation roles
- Create and own automation strategy documentation, coding guidelines, and onboarding guides for team members
Preferred Qualifications
- Familiarity with mobile automation frameworks like Appium or Detox
- Domain knowledge of healthcare data or experience with enterprise SaaS products
